A quadcopter, also called a quadrotor helicopter or quadrotor, is a multirotor helicopter that is lifted and propelled by four rotors. Quadcopters are classified as rotorcraft, as opposed to fixedwing aircraft, because their lift is generated by a set of rotors vertically oriented propellers quadcopters generally use two pairs of identical fixed pitch propellers. This arduino sketch provides a flight controller for an x quadcopter based on an arduino uno board and the mpu6050 sensor basically, this automation routine is an implementation of a digital pid with a refresh rate of 250hz. The arduino is capable of receiving the standard servo control signal output by a hobby radio receiver you can plug the arduino in to the receiver in place of one or more servos and it is also capable of generating the servo control signal you can plug the servo into the arduino instead of into the receiver.
